1-Amino-1H-Pyrrole-2-Carbonitrile Hydrochloride

Description:
1-Amino-1H-pyrrole-2-carbonitrile hydrochloride is a chemical compound characterized by its pyrrole ring structure, which is a five-membered aromatic heterocycle containing nitrogen. This compound features an amino group and a cyano group attached to the pyrrole ring, contributing to its reactivity and potential applications in organic synthesis and medicinal chemistry. The hydrochloride form indicates that the compound is a salt formed with hydrochloric acid, which often enhances its solubility in water and stability. The presence of the amino and cyano groups suggests that it may participate in various chemical reactions, such as nucleophilic substitutions or cycloadditions. This compound may be of interest in the development of pharmaceuticals or agrochemicals due to its unique structural features.
